Those postponing marriage for the first time are at record highs; the highest rates since before the 1900’s. (1)
-Percent of men never married is almost 35% and women is almost 30%
-These rates are like those during times of war or natural disaster.
56% of those 18-34 years old that have never married desire to be. (2)
-26% Say the reason they are not married is because they have not found the right person.

STD’s are at epidemic rates in the US. (5)
-With 110 million infected out of 323 million population.
-50% of the new infections are in people ages 15-24.
-HPV accounts for over half of all STD’s.
-It can be spread not only through sex but by kissing.
-It causes cancer of the cervix, genitals, throat, neck and head.
